    "The History of Geoconservation" ed. by C. V. Burek, C. D. Prosser
    Geological Society of London Special Publications, Vol. 300
    GSL | 2008 | ISBN: 1862392544 9781862392540 | 311 pages | PDF | 9 MB

    This book provides the collection of papers to address the history of geoconservation. The papers demonstrate that the origin and development of this subject is interesting and informative in itself but more importantly, through revealing the history of geoconservation successes and failures, they provide us with an increased understanding of how we got to where we are now; invaluable knowledge in helping geoconservation meet the challenges that lie in the future.

    This book is the first to describe the history of geoconservation. It draws on experience from the UK, Europe and further afield.
    It seeks to explore the origins of the subject and the concepts that helped to define it; it describes the history of geoconservation in the UK, looks more widely to the Republic of Ireland, mainland Europe and Australia and explores the evolution and impact of global conservation initiatives including World Heritage sites and Geoparks. In doing this, it highlights the invaluable contributions to geoconservation made by academics, geological societies, governments, conservationists, volunteers and local communities.
